Output 0543fc5ed46d3566fef77584194c0dfc0256e0d90e814e6a5c6a1b99b7d6ecd0: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f99bae3789671a6a8c2cc66ca667924c35 OP_EQUAL
address
3BMEXeApHf1QWPuKZXhwsWAcMZCsZTWtLU
transaction
0543fc5ed46d3566fef77584194c0dfc0256e0d90e814e6a5c6a1b99b7d6ecd0
confirmations
358975
spent
true